How Conakry's prayer times are worked out
From Conakry, the Qibla is 70° from true north. Face east to pray toward the Kaaba. It lies 5,855 km (3,638 miles) away in a straight line across the globe. Every time on this page is worked out from Conakry's own coordinates (9.54°N, 13.68°W), not a national average. That is why Conakry's times and its Qibla differ a little from cities a short distance away.
Conakry sits just 9.54°N of the equator. Its prayer calendar barely shifts across the year. With the Muslim World League method, the longest daily fast is about 13h 58m. The shortest is about 12h 50m. That is a swing of only 1h 08m between June and December. Whenever Ramadan falls, fasting hours here stay much the same — something cities farther from the equator never see.
The Fajr and Isha angles for Conakry come from the Muslim World League. The Muslim World League method sets Fajr when the sun is 18° below the horizon, and Isha at 17°. Use ISNA's 15° instead and Fajr here would move by several minutes. So the method — not the coordinates alone — settles the final time. We also publish times for nearby Camayenne, Dixinn and Dubréka. Each is only a few minutes off Conakry's clock.

Who oversees prayer in Guinea
Guinea's religious life is coordinated by the Secretariat General of Religious Affairs, a government body dating to 1977. It manages worship, pilgrimage and the public confirmation of Ramadan and Eid dates. About 85% of Guineans are Muslim, mostly Sunni in the Maliki tradition, with strong Qadiri and Tijani Sufi currents. The standard Asr shown here therefore matches local practice. This page applies the Muslim World League calculation (Fajr 18°, Isha 17°) to this city's own coordinates. Guinea keeps GMT year-round. Conakry at 13.7°W sees solar noon nearly an hour after clock noon, so sun-based times run 'late' by the clock. The per-city calculation here absorbs that automatically.
The Grand Mosque of Conakry
The Grand Mosque of Conakry opened in 1982 under President Sékou Touré, built with Saudi funding. It holds some 12,500 worshippers inside and ranks among the largest mosques in West Africa. Its gardens hold the Camayanne Mausoleum, the resting place of national heroes including Samori Touré and Sékou Touré himself. Conakry sits close to the equator at 9.5°N, so day length stays steady across the year. Ramadan's fasting hours barely change whether it falls in June or December. At European latitudes they swing much more widely. The five daily prayers structure Guinean days, from the capital's corniche mosques to the highland towns of Fouta Djallon. That region is a historic heartland of West African Islamic scholarship.

Conakry Prayer Times — FAQ
What direction is Qibla from Conakry?
The Qibla direction from Conakry, Guinea is 70° from true north. Face east toward Mecca, Saudi Arabia, which lies 5,855 km (3,638 miles) away.
How long is the fast in Conakry?
The longest daily fast in Conakry is about 13h 58m, around June. The shortest is about 12h 50m, in December. That is a swing of 1h 08m across the year, set by the city's latitude of 9.54°N. Both are measured from Fajr to Maghrib with the Muslim World League method.
How stable are prayer times in Guinea across the year?
Very stable — Conakry sits at 9.5°N, so day length changes little between seasons and each prayer time drifts by minutes rather than hours. The clock is GMT year-round with no daylight saving. Note the longitude effect. At 13.7°W, solar noon comes nearly an hour after clock noon, so Dhuhr and Maghrib fall late by the clock. This page's calculation already accounts for it.
